Luc Ferrari is a scholar working on Pharmacology, Molecular Biology and Materials Chemistry. According to data from OpenAlex, Luc Ferrari has authored 51 papers receiving a total of 886 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Pharmacology, 9 papers in Molecular Biology and 9 papers in Materials Chemistry. Recurrent topics in Luc Ferrari’s work include Pharmacogenetics and Drug Metabolism (9 papers), Nanoparticles: synthesis and applications (8 papers) and Eicosanoids and Hypertension Pharmacology (7 papers). Luc Ferrari is often cited by papers focused on Pharmacogenetics and Drug Metabolism (9 papers), Nanoparticles: synthesis and applications (8 papers) and Eicosanoids and Hypertension Pharmacology (7 papers). Luc Ferrari collaborates with scholars based in France, Ireland and United States. Luc Ferrari's co-authors include Anne‐Marie Batt, Gérard Siest, Edward T. Morgan, Olivier Joubert, J.P. Giroud, I. Florentin, Laurence Chauvelot‐Moachon, G. Galassi, L Xerri and Enza Di Modugno and has published in prestigious journals such as International Journal of Molecular Sciences, Antimicrobial Agents and Chemotherapy and Journal of Pharmacology and Experimental Therapeutics.
